The Central District of Hashtrud County ( Persian: بخش مرکزی شهرستان هشترود) is in East Azerbaijan province, Iran. Its capital is the city of Hashtrud. [3]

At the National Census in 2006, its population was 45,982 in 10,428 households. [4] The following census in 2011 counted 44,776 people in 12,207 households. [5] At the latest census in 2016, the district had 43,463 inhabitants in 13,143 households. [2]

Central District (Hashtrud County) Population
Administrative Divisions 2006 [4] 2011 [5] 2016 [2]
Aliabad RD 5,595 4,923 4,320
Charuymaq-e Shomalesharqi RD 1,445 1,327 1,141
Kuhsar RD 4,318 3,806 3,559
Qaranqu RD 11,929 10,858 10,263
Soluk RD 4,277 3,959 3,608
Hashtrud (city) 18,418 19,903 20,572
Total 45,982 44,776 43,463
RD = Rural District
